Visit the LEGO website and use their missing parts service to request replacement pieces. Ensure you have the set number and part details.
Store LEGO pieces in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ight to prevent discoloration and warping.
Disassemble and carefully clean the pieces with a mild soap solution and a soft brush, then reassemble to ensure tight joints.
It is not recommended to wash LEGO pieces in a dishwasher. Instead, clean them by hand with warm water and mild soap.
Check for any debris or damage on the pieces. Ensure you are using the correct pieces as indicated in the instructions.
Ensure surfaces are clean and dry before application. Use a small amount of adhesive to reattach any peeling stickers.
Use a LEGO brick separator tool to carefully pry apart pieces without applying excessive force.
Yes, LEGO sets are designed to be compatible with each other, allowing for creative combinations and custom builds.
Sort pieces by size, color, or type into separate containers or compartments to keep them organized and easily accessible.
